This is basically half off of the $50 plan. Give AT&T $300 upfront, you don't have to pay for a year and you get 8 GB of data each month. New lines of activation only, and this deal expires 10/21/19.

Between this and the WalMart 25 GB plan I fully expect a few permanent changes at AT&T Prepaid. These are my projections for next year
  • 8 GB data each month becomes the new minimum
  • The price of the unlimited plan moves from $65 a month to $50 a month
  • Advanced Messaging comes to AT&T Prepaid after it comes to Cricket first.

Keep in mind we're just now getting Wi-Fi Calling and HD Voice. The latter of which is not available on their cheaper phones, but the sound quality over Wi-Fi is good enough that does not matter, IMO. Advanced Messaging, now I'm just getting hopeful; I think Cricket will get it next year or even 2021, and if it proves successful there it will make it's way over to AT&T Prepaid.

I just did the online chat w/Altice mobile sales, since I'm in a zip that this is being offered, and I also happen to be shopping for a new phone/mobile plan right now. After asking a a ton of questions, this does seem to be legit. The $20 plan is a lifetime plan (not subject to random, stupid hikes like their cable/internet service) as long as you're enrolled in autopay, otherwise it's an extra $5/mo.

So the stores sell iPhones 6 and up, which is what I'm buying (the XR). It will be locked for the first 90 days, then unlocked thereafter. This pricing really seems too good to be true, I'm looking for the catch. I don't like that online chat is the only way to communicate to their mobile customer service. I have Altice cable/internet right now and I can verify that their customer service is beyond dismal, approaching absolutely atrocious. So I'm a bit leery of using them for mobile service too. But with this pricing, I may have to check it out. Unlimited everything for $20/month? Pretty crazy.
